How does one hold the law in disregard while obeying it? Long as one obeys it in deed, one's speech cannot be considered seditious in any state but a totalitarian dictatorship.

Let me pose another example. During the Holocaust in Nazi Germany, it was illegal for German citizens to give any refuge to Jews fleeing from genocidal persecution. The common German citizen with a vestige of morality would contend that such a law was inhuman, but still would obey it, for fear of the Reich's monstrous retaliation. Yet, at the same time, he would likely hold in high esteem those who undertook the courageous task of offering the Jews shelter despite the death threats arrayed against them.

Moreover, working within the law is precisely what Miller suggests via a grass-roots abolition movement, but do keep in mind that, while I essentially agree with that method in this case, there are certain instances, such as that in Nazi Germany or any state that forcefully institutes a draft upon its citizens (which is what my first example reminds me of), where the only means of retaliation on the citizens' part is outright disobedience and evasion.
